3. What are academic references?

You have been asked to find a minimum of SIX (6) academic references with at least FOUR (4) from academic (peer reviewed/scholarly/refereed)  journal articles. 

Academic references can be referred to scholarly sources or peer reviewed (refereed). These can include journal articles, books, book chapters, reports and other sources.  To find out more about academic references look at the below resources.

Tip: When searching in the library catalogue you can filter your results to show only 'peer reviewed'

Google Scholar is also a good place to search to find scholarly material. An advantage of Google Scholar is that it provides access to the full text of many UniSA scholarly/academic articles if you connect to it via the link above, or from the Library home page

The Advanced search option gives more flexibility when you search (note you will have to click on the hamburger menu  then select Advanced search).

What do you do with all those references you have found?

Use a bibliographic management software to store, organise and cite your references. The Library supports the bibliographic management tool EndNote. There are also many free systems available.
